I'm doing the 1K service myself and I wanted to know if anyone had the size for the O ring on the Primary that I am supposed to replace (according to the users manual). It isn't a part that I have to get exclusively from Harley do I?
My local HD dealer charges $1.75 each for those o-rings. The auto parts store down the road has the same size o-ring for $0.25 each. I have a bag of them hanging on my garage wall.
Just a little food for thought. The derby cover o-ring is a one time use one also.
Yes, but many have reused the stock derby cover o-ring gasket numerous times with out problems. If you change the derby cover to one of the accessory covers then you will need one of the disk type gaskets and some forum members have reused even those. I would take a chance with the o-ring gasket if it were in good shape and not damaged. I have always changed the disk type gasket, as the sealing material on the disk is very thin.
Right, I did away with the stock derby cover o-ring gasket awhile back when I changed to a chrome primary cover and derby cover. If the o-rings on the plugs are not cut or damaged I always just reuse them.
